データベース移行は、システム開発プロジェクトの中でも特にリスクが高い作業の一つです。データの損失や整合性の崩壊は、ビジネスに直接的な損害を与えます。IPAの調査によると、データ移行プロジェクトの約25%で何らかのトラブルが発生しており、その多くは「事前の計画不足」と「テスト不足」に起因しています。本記事では、データベース移行を外注する際に知っておくべき費用相場、リスク対策、依頼先の選び方を解説します。
データベース移行の主なパターンと費用相場
移行パターン別の費用
| 移行パターン | 費用相場 | 期間 | 難易度 |
|---|---|---|---|
| 同一DBMS間の移行(バージョンアップ) | 50万〜200万円 | 1〜3ヶ月 | 低〜中 |
| 異なるDBMS間の移行(例:Oracle→PostgreSQL) | 200万〜800万円 | 3〜6ヶ月 | 高 |
| オンプレミス→クラウドDB移行 | 150万〜500万円 | 2〜5ヶ月 | 中〜高 |
| レガシーDB→モダンDB移行 | 300万〜1,500万円 | 4〜12ヶ月 | 非常に高 |
| データ統合(複数DB→1つのDB) | 200万〜1,000万円 | 3〜8ヶ月 | 高 |
出典:IPA「ソフトウェア開発データ白書」を基にGXO作成
費用に影響する主な要因
| 要因 | 影響度 | 説明 |
|---|---|---|
| データ量 | 大 | TB単位のデータは移行時間とテスト工数が増大 |
| テーブル数 | 大 | テーブル間のリレーション変換が必要 |
| データの品質 | 大 | 不整合データのクレンジングが必要 |
| ダウンタイムの制約 | 中 | ゼロダウンタイム要件は難易度が大幅に上昇 |
| アプリケーション改修 | 大 | DBMS変更に伴うSQLやORMの書き換え |
| セキュリティ要件 | 中 | 暗号化、マスキングの対応 |
INSTANT ESTIMATE
計算式より、60秒で概算を出しませんか?
システム種別・規模・連携先を選ぶだけで、開発費用・期間・月額運用費の概算をその場で表示します。
データベース移行のリスクと対策
主要リスク一覧
| リスク | 発生確率 | 影響度 | 対策 |
|---|---|---|---|
| データ損失 | 低 | 致命的 | 移行前の完全バックアップ、検証環境での事前テスト |
| データ不整合 | 高 | 高 | データ検証ツールによる移行前後の自動比較 |
| パフォーマンス低下 | 中 | 高 | 移行先での負荷テスト実施 |
| ダウンタイム超過 | 中 | 高 | リハーサル実施、ロールバック計画の策定 |
| アプリケーション障害 | 高 | 高 | 結合テスト・回帰テストの徹底 |
| セキュリティ侵害 | 低 | 致命的 | 移行データの暗号化、アクセス権限の見直し |
リスク軽減のための5つの鉄則
1. リハーサルは最低3回実施する
本番移行前に、本番と同じ環境・同じデータ量でリハーサルを実施します。1回目で問題を発見し、2回目で修正を確認し、3回目で手順を確立します。
2. ロールバック計画を必ず策定する
移行が失敗した場合に、元の状態に戻す手順を事前に確定しておきます。ロールバックの判断基準(どの時点で中止するか)も明確にしておきましょう。
3. データ検証は自動化する
移行前後のデータ件数・合計値・チェックサムを自動で比較するスクリプトを準備します。手動検証では見落としが発生します。
4. 段階的に移行する
一気にすべてを移行するのではなく、テーブル単位やサービス単位で段階的に移行することでリスクを分散できます。
5. 移行後の監視体制を強化する
移行直後の1〜2週間は監視を強化し、パフォーマンス低下やエラーの早期検出に努めます。
データベース移行の外注先の選び方
依頼先の3タイプ
| タイプ | 特徴 | 費用感 | 適した移行 |
|---|---|---|---|
| DBスペシャリスト企業 | DB移行に特化した専門企業 | 中〜高 | 大規模・高難度の移行 |
| SIer・開発会社 | システム全体を見渡せる | 高 | アプリ改修を伴う移行 |
| クラウドベンダーのパートナー | AWSやAzureの認定パートナー | 中 | クラウド移行 |
選定時の5つのチェックポイント
- 同種の移行実績:同じDBMS間の移行実績があるか
- 移行ツール・手法:どのような移行ツールを使うか
- テスト方針:データ検証の方法と範囲
- リスク管理:ロールバック計画の策定を含むか
- サポート体制:移行後の運用サポートがあるか
外注時に伝えるべき情報チェックリスト
データベース移行を外注する際は、以下の情報を整理して伝えましょう。
システム情報
- 現行DBMSの種類とバージョン
- 移行先DBMSの種類とバージョン(決まっている場合)
- データ量(レコード数、容量)
- テーブル数とリレーション
- ストアドプロシージャ・トリガーの有無と数
- 使用しているDB固有機能
業務要件
- 許容されるダウンタイム
- 移行後のパフォーマンス要件
- データ保持期間(全期間 or 直近N年分のみ)
- コンプライアンス要件(データの保管場所、暗号化)
予算・スケジュール
- 予算の上限
- 移行希望時期
- 移行作業が可能な曜日・時間帯
クラウドDB移行の注意点
オンプレミスからクラウドDBへの移行は、近年最も多い移行パターンの一つです。
クラウドDB移行の費用比較
| 移行先 | 費用目安(移行作業) | 月額ランニング | 特徴 |
|---|---|---|---|
| Amazon RDS | 100万〜300万円 | 3万〜30万円 | 最も実績が豊富 |
| Amazon Aurora | 150万〜400万円 | 5万〜50万円 | 高性能・高可用性 |
| Azure SQL Database | 100万〜300万円 | 3万〜30万円 | Microsoft製品との親和性 |
| Google Cloud SQL | 100万〜300万円 | 3万〜30万円 | BigQueryとの連携 |
出典:各クラウドベンダーの公開料金を基にGXO作成
クラウド移行特有のリスク
- ネットワークレイテンシによるパフォーマンス変化
- データ転送コスト(大量データの移行時)
- リージョン選択によるコンプライアンスの問題
- クラウド固有のセキュリティ設定の不備
<div style="background:#f0f9ff;border:2px solid #0ea5e9;border-radius:8px;padding:24px;margin:32px 0;text-align:center;">
データベース移行、リスクを最小限に抑えたいなら
GXO株式会社では、データベース移行に関する無料相談を実施しています。「移行先のDBMSが決まっていない」「ダウンタイムを最小限にしたい」「移行コストを抑えたい」など、どんなご相談もお気軽にどうぞ。豊富な移行実績を持つエンジニアが最適な移行プランをご提案します。
</div> <!-- GXO_QUALITY_REWRITE_20260507_START -->GXO実務追記: レガシー刷新で発注前に確認すべきこと
この記事のテーマは、単なるトレンド紹介ではなく、現行調査、刷新範囲、段階移行、ROI、ベンダー切替リスクを決めるための検討材料です。検索で情報収集している段階でも、発注前に次の観点を整理しておくと、見積もりのブレ、手戻り、ベンダー依存を減らせます。
まず決めるべき3つの論点
| 論点 | 確認する内容 | 未整理のまま進めた場合のリスク |
|---|---|---|
| 目的 | 売上拡大、工数削減、リスク低減、顧客体験改善のどれを優先するか | 成果指標が曖昧になり、PoCや開発が終わっても投資判断できない |
| 範囲 | 対象部署、対象業務、対象データ、対象システムをどこまで含めるか | 見積もりが膨らむ、または重要な連携が後から漏れる |
| 体制 | 自社責任者、現場担当、ベンダー、保守運用者をどう置くか | 要件確認が遅れ、納期遅延や品質低下につながる |
費用・期間・体制の目安
| フェーズ | 期間目安 | 主な成果物 | GXOが見るポイント |
|---|---|---|---|
| 事前診断 | 1〜2週間 | 課題整理、現行確認、投資判断メモ | 目的と範囲が商談前に整理されているか |
| 要件定義 / 設計 | 3〜6週間 | 要件一覧、RFP、概算見積、ロードマップ | 見積比較できる粒度になっているか |
| PoC / MVP | 1〜3ヶ月 | 検証環境、効果測定、リスク評価 | 本番化判断に必要な数値が取れるか |
| 本番導入 | 3〜6ヶ月 | 本番環境、運用設計、教育、改善計画 | 導入後の運用責任と改善サイクルがあるか |
発注前チェックリスト
- 現行システムの機能、利用部署、データ、外部連携を一覧化したか
- 保守切れ、属人化、障害頻度、セキュリティリスクを金額換算したか
- 全面刷新、段階移行、SaaS置換、リホストの比較表を作ったか
- 移行中に止められない業務と、止めてもよい業務を分けたか
- 既存ベンダー依存から抜けるためのドキュメント/コード引継ぎ条件を決めたか
- 稟議で説明する投資回収、リスク低減、保守費削減の根拠を整理したか
参考にすべき一次情報・公的情報
上記の一次情報は、社内稟議やベンダー比較の根拠として使えます。一方で、公開情報だけでは自社の現行システム、業務フロー、データ状態、予算制約までは判断できません。記事で一般論を把握した後は、自社条件に落とした診断が必要です。
GXOに相談するタイミング
次のいずれかに当てはまる場合は、記事を読み進めるだけでなく、早めに相談した方が安全です。
- 見積もり依頼前に、要件やRFPの粒度を整えたい
- 既存ベンダーの提案が妥当か第三者視点で確認したい
- 補助金、AI、セキュリティ、レガシー刷新が絡み、判断軸が複雑になっている
- 社内稟議で費用対効果、リスク、ロードマップを説明する必要がある
- PoCや診断で終わらせず、本番導入と運用改善まで進めたい
<!-- GXO_QUALITY_REWRITE_20260507_END -->データベース移行の外注ガイド|費用相場・リスク・依頼先の選び方を自社条件で診断したい方へ
GXOが、現状整理、RFP/要件定義、費用対効果、ベンダー比較、導入ロードマップまで実務目線で確認します。記事の一般論を、自社の投資判断に使える形へ落とし込みます。
※ 初回相談では営業資料の説明よりも、現状・課題・判断材料の整理を優先します。



